Stainless Steel Gear Rack Laser Cutting

Stainless steel gear rack laser cutting involves the use of advanced laser technology to precisely cut stainless steel gear racks. This method offers high accuracy, clean cuts, and minimal material waste. Additionally, it allows for intricate designs and complex shapes, making it ideal for various applications.

Types of Stainless Steel Gear Rack

There are various types of stainless steel gear racks available, each with unique characteristics and advantages:

  • Straight Tooth Gear Rack: Provides high precision and load capacity.
  • Helical Tooth Gear Rack: Offers smoother operation and reduced noise.
  • Rack and Pinion Gear Set: Enables linear motion and efficient power transmission.
  • Flexible Gear Rack: Allows for flexibility in movement and adaptability to different applications.

Maintenance of Stainless Steel Gear Rack

To ensure the longevity and performance of stainless steel gear racks, proper maintenance is essential:

  • Regular Equipment Inspection: Conduct routine inspections to identify any wear, damage, or misalignment.
  • Cleaning and Corrosion Prevention: Clean the gear racks regularly and apply suitable corrosion prevention measures.
  • Lubrication and Lubricant Selection: Lubricate the gear racks as recommended, using appropriate lubricants to minimize friction and wear.
  • Replacement of Worn Parts: Replace any worn or damaged gear rack components promptly to avoid further issues.
